Pass on the BHP thing.. I know UK cars were 265ps or 305ps if PPP fitted. I'd estimate the JDM at around 280ps on Jap Fuel, but could be wrong. Obviously if the car has modifications on it then the power figure should rise slightly.

Is there evidence of it having a service at 19k miles... Stamped book, new parts, reciepts etc?? From memory, a MAF sensor can fail pretty quickly so it might not have been picked up over 1000 miles ago when it was last serviced.
